Comprehending the Basics

Before diving into the application process, it's crucial to comprehend the fundamental requirements and kinds of driving licenses offered. Driving laws vary considerably from nation to nation, and even within various states or provinces within the exact same nation. Normally, there are several types of driving licenses, consisting of:

  • Learner's Permit: This is typically the first action in the procedure, enabling new chauffeurs to acquire experience under guidance.
  • Provisionary License: Issued after passing a fundamental driving test, this license usually comes with constraints and is a stepping stone to a complete license.
  • Full Driver's License: Once all the essential requirements are met, drivers can obtain a complete license, which uses total driving advantages.
  • Business Driver's License (CDL): Required for those who want to run commercial automobiles, such as trucks or buses.

Steps to Obtain a Driving License

1. Research Local Driving Laws

The first action in obtaining a driving license is to look into the specific requirements in your location. Visit the main site of your regional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) or comparable firm to discover detailed information about the licensing procedure, including age limitations, required documents, and fees.

2. Prepare Required Documentation

Each jurisdiction has its own set of documents that must be sent to look for a driving license. Typically required files consist of:

  • Proof of Residency: Utility bills, lease agreements, or other main files that verify your address.
  • Social Security Number (if applicable): In some nations, a social security number or equivalent is needed for recognition.
  • Vision Test Results: Some places need a vision test before providing a student's authorization or license.

3. Take a Driver's Education Course

Numerous states and nations require new motorists to complete a driver's education course. These courses are designed to teach the guidelines of the road, traffic laws, and safe driving practices. They can be completed online or in a class setting and typically include both theoretical and useful parts.

4. Obtain a Learner's Permit

As soon as the required paperwork is all set and the driver's education course is finished, the next step is to get a student's permit. This normally includes visiting the DMV or submitting an application online. You will likewise require to pass a written test that covers traffic laws and driving understanding.

5. Practice Driving

With a student's license, you can start practicing driving under the guidance of a licensed adult. This is an essential step in building your self-confidence and skills behind the wheel. It's also crucial to get experience in numerous driving conditions, such as night driving, highway driving, and driving in harsh weather condition.

6. Set up and Pass the Driving Test

The test will assess your capability to securely operate an automobile and follow traffic laws. You will need to bring a correctly signed up and insured automobile to the test, and the inspector will assess your driving abilities on a fixed path.

7. Apply for a Provisional License

If you pass the driving test, you will generally get a provisionary license. This license may come with constraints, such as a curfew or a limitation on the variety of guests you can have in the car. These constraints are developed to decrease the risk of accidents and assist new drivers accustom to the roadway.

8. Upgrade to a Full License

When you have held a provisionary license for the necessary duration and met any extra requirements, you can upgrade to a full driver's license. This process usually includes an easy application and might need a retest or additional documents.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the minimum age to make an application for a student's license?

A: The minimum age differs by jurisdiction. In the United States, it generally ranges from 15 to 16 years of ages. In the UK, the minimum age is 17. Check your regional DMV site for specific information.

Q: Can I make an application for a driver's license online?

A: Some jurisdictions permit you to complete parts of the application procedure online, such as filling out types and scheduling tests. However, you will normally need to visit a DMV workplace personally to submit required files and take the driving test.

Q: What takes place if I stop working the driving test?

A: If you fail the driving test, you can typically retake it after a certain duration. This duration varies by location, however it is frequently a few weeks. It's a great concept to practice more before retaking the test to improve your chances of success.

Q: Can I drive alone with a student's permit?

A: No, a student's license normally needs you to be accompanied by a licensed adult, usually over 21 years of ages, who is seated in the front passenger seat.

Q: Is a vision test required to get a driving license?

A: Yes, the majority of jurisdictions need a vision test to make sure that you can safely operate a lorry. You can typically take this test at the DMV or with an authorized optometrist.

Q: How long does it require to get a full driver's license?

A: The time required to get a full driver's license differs depending on your jurisdiction and the specific actions involved. Normally, it can take a number of months, including the time required to complete a driver's education course, hold a learner's permit, and pass the driving test.

Q: Can I use a provisional license to drive for work?

A: It depends on the limitations put on your provisionary license. Some provisionary licenses allow you to drive for work, while others may have specific constraints. Examine your license for details or contact the DMV for information.

Q: What is the difference between a learner's permit and a provisional license?

A: A student's authorization is the first stage of the licensing process and permits you to drive just under guidance. A provisional license, on the other hand, grants you more driving advantages but might still have some limitations, such as a curfew or guest limitations.

Q: What should I do if I lose my driving license?

A: If you lose your driving license, you ought to report it to the DMV and look for a replacement. You may need to provide proof of identity and pay a cost. It's likewise an excellent concept to inform your insurance company and any other appropriate celebrations.
